Here’s your guide to reading the Ohio School Report Card
COLUMBUS — Kids aren’t the only ones getting grades. Every fall, the Ohio Department of Education and Workforce releases its Ohio School Report Cards. These report cards rate public schools on things like student achievement, academic progress, early literacy and graduation rates.
